Diary of Private Lewis C. Paxson, Saturday, March 21, 1863
I got out 18 lines
of Virgil; 27 refugees came up from Georgetown with Capt. McCoy and Tyler. Warm
and snow melting. An old squaw 120 years old among the Chippewas.
SOURCE: Lewis C.
Paxson, Diary of Lewis C. Paxson: Stockton, N.J., 1862-1865, p. 14
